// Plugin authors: this client batches entity lookups through the
// Quillbatch loader, which resolves our earlier GraphQL N+1 problem by
// coalescing per-field fetches into a single keyed request per tick.
// Do not bypass the loader with direct resolver calls, or the N+1
// pattern returns. The loader authenticates against the internal
// Quillbatch gateway with the key below.

API key for kahop-bagef: zpat2_yb

## Fixing Role Mix-ups in GreenQuill Wiki

If someone says they can't edit a page, check whether they're in the Contributor group, not just Viewer. Reassign the role, wait two minutes for the cache to clear, then have them reload. When escalating, include the build token shown below so engineering knows which release they hit.

trace token, yagag-bageg: htk4_b40e

Subject: KeyTurner v2.3 rolling out tonight

Hi all — the KeyTurner secrets-rotation utility ships to staging at 22:00. For the new contractor: KeyTurner rotates service credentials across the Bramblewick fleet nightly; no manual steps needed. Runbook is on the wiki. When filing any issue, quote the build token below.

pipeline stamp: htk9_ce63042d9

**Ticket: KioskPal watchdog restarts plugins too eagerly**

Hey plugin folks — a few of you reported that the KioskPal watchdog kills your plugin process if the heartbeat is late by even a second. That's our bug, not yours; the grace window got dropped in the last refactor. Workaround for now: send heartbeats every 5s instead of 10s. When filing follow-ups, include the watchdog build you're running, like the one shown here.

pipeline stamp: htk31_f769b577b3028a4e9958e5bb8d1259a